The Arrowverse has presented us with plenty of villains over the years, but which of its big bads stole the show and which ones fell a little short?

No superheroes forget their first major villain. It’s their first real test that pushes them to their limits and ultimately sets the stage for their career-defining victory that saves those who need them.

The CW’s legendary Arrowverse showcased that well. For the Green Arrow, his first challenge was the Dark Archer, The Flash found himself up against the Reverse-Flash, Supergirl and Batwoman took on family, and the Legends battled an immortal tyrant across time. All of these great heroes overcame insurmountable odds to save the day.

But the Arrowverse told a long story, and with that came plenty of villains. Yes, across ArrowThe FlashSupergirlDC’s Legends of Tomorrow, and Batwoman, there were countless great villains and threats for our heroes to take on. But not all of them were up for the challenge.

With that in mind, and the unfortunate end of the Arrowverse having come and gone, let’s reflect on all of the shared universe’s major villains and figure out which of them were the best (and which were the worst).

Note: While there were countless villains across Arrowverse shows, this list will take a look at the major season villains. It also won’t include shows that spent the majority of their runs as Arrowverse-adjacent (such as Black Lightning, DC’s Stargirl, or Superman and Lois).
